Factors Affecting Cost
- Material Choice: Different materials like concrete, brick, or natural stone vary in price.
- Walkway Size: Larger walkways require more materials and labor.
- Design Complexity: Intricate patterns or custom designs can increase costs.
- Site Preparation: Clearing and leveling the site may add to the expense.
- Labor Costs: Local labor rates in Murrells Inlet can affect the overall price.
- Permits and Regulations: Obtaining necessary permits may incur additional fees.
- Accessibility: Difficult-to-reach areas can lead to higher installation costs.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Murrells Inlet, SC) |
---|---|
Basic Concrete Walkway (per sq. ft.) | $8 - $12 |
Brick Paver Walkway (per sq. ft.) | $10 - $18 |
Natural Stone Walkway (per sq. ft.) | $15 - $30 |
Site Preparation (per hour) | $50 - $75 |
Custom Design and Pattern | Additional $5 - $10 per sq. ft. |
Permit Fees | $100 - $200 |
